WebNov 21, 2024 · A cytokine storm is an abnormal discharge of soluble mediators following an inappropriate inflammatory response that leads to immunopathological events. Cytokine storms can occur after severe infections as well as in non-infectious situations where inflammatory cytokine responses are initiated, then exaggerated, but fail to return to ... WebOct 3, 2024 · In cytokine storm, activation of complement contributes to tissue damage, inhibition may reduce immunopathologic effects Open in a separate window CS means … WebJul 12, 2024 · There is no established definition of what a “cytokine storm” is, although the term was first coined in 1993 to describe the dramatic effects of IL-1 in graft-versus-host disease [14]. WebApr 10, 2024 · A cytokine storm occurs in a variety of conditions: Macrophage activation syndrome (MAS) often occurs in people with an autoimmune disorder such as lupus, … WebJun 16, 2024 · Cytokine storm (CS) is a critical life-threating condition requiring intensive care admission and having a quite high mortality. CS is characterized by a clinical presentation of overwhelming systemic inflammation, hyperferritinemia, hemodynamic instability, and multi-organ failure, and if left untreated, it leads to death. ...
